انواع زبان برنامه نویسی

زبان های برنامه نویسی مختلف مانند برنامه نویسی جاوا، برنامه نویسی پایتون، برنامه نویسی C و…در سال های اخیر با گسترش سیستم عامل های ویندوز و اندروید، تقاضای زیادی برای آن ها شد‌ه است. زبان‌های برنامه‌نویسی، زبان‌های مبتنی بر دستور در رایانه‌ها هستند. درادامه بیشتر درمورد انواع زبان برنامه نویسی بیشتر صحبت میکنیم .

از طریق آن‌ها می‌توان الگوریتمی را با استفاده از ساختارهای دستوری مختلف برای پردازش رایانه توصیف کرد و با این روش می‌توان برنامه‌ای برای تولید نرم‌افزار جدید نوشت. در این مقاله به مقایسه انواع زبان های برنامه نویسی و معرفی زبان های برنامه نویسی تحت وب، زبان های برنامه نویسی دسکتاپ و زبان های برنامه نویسی موبایل می پردازیم.

انواع زبان برنامه نویسی چیست

زبان برنامه نویسی یک زبان رسمی است که شامل مجموعه ای از دستورالعمل ها است و خروجی های مختلفی تولید می کند. از زبان های برنامه نویسی برای ایجاد الگوریتم استفاده می شود.

از این رو هزاران زبان برنامه نویسی برای کاربردهای مختلف ساخته شد‌ه و هر سال بر تعداد آنها افزوده می شود. اما برخی از آنها کاربردهای گسترده و تقاضای زیادی برای کار دارند. اگر در ابتدای برنامه نویسی هستید، ممکن است تعجب کنید که کدام زبان برنامه نویسی برای یادگیری بهتر است؟ در پاسخ به این سوال باید بگویید که نمی توان تشخیص داد کدام زبان برنامه نویسی خوب یا بد است و باید با توجه به نیاز خود و با تصمیم گیری در مورد روش انتخابی و پلتفرم، زبان برنامه نویسی مناسب را برای یادگیری انتخاب کنید.

مهارت های سازمانی یکی از رایج ترین مهارت ها در بازار کار امروزی است. همانطور که بسیاری از مشاغل به سمت فناوری های دیجیتال و آنلاین می روند، نیاز به افرادی وجود دارد که بتوانند انواع مختلف کد را بنویسند و درک کنند. ما به چند زبان برنامه نویسی مختلف و کاربرد آنها نگاه می کنیم.

انواع زبان برنامه نویسی

انواع زبان های برنامه نویسی

اگر بخواهیم زبان های برنامه نویسی را بر اساس پلتفرم مورد استفاده تقسیم بندی کنیم، چهار دسته زیر پذیرفته می شوند:

زبان های برنامه نویسی زیر دسکتاپ

برای توسعه ویندوز و نرم افزار دسکتاپ به زبان های برنامه نویسی دسکتاپ نیاز است. برخی از رایج ترین زبان های برنامه نویسی زیر دسکتاپ عبارتند از: سی، جاوا، پایتون، پرل، ویژوال بیسیک

زبان های برنامه نویسی وب

زبان های برنامه نویسی وب به دو دسته زبان های برنامه نویسی سمت کاربر (Front End) و زبان های برنامه نویسی سمت سرور (Back End) تقسیم می شوند.برخی از زبان های برنامه نویسی / نشانه گذاری گروه کاربری عبارتند از:

HTML، CSS، جاوا اسکریپت، جی کوئری

برخی از زبان های برنامه نویسی سمت سرور عبارتند از:

جاوا، پی اچ پی، روبی، پایتون، ASP.NET

زبان های برنامه نویسی موبایل

برای توسعه اپلیکیشن های موبایل می توان از زبان های برنامه نویسی مخصوص هر پلتفرم (اندروید، iOS و…) استفاده کرد. برخی از این زبان ها عبارتند از:

جبا این حال، بسیاری از زبان های برنامه نویسی مدرن ریشه در اولین الگوریتم ماشین آدا لاولیس دارند که برای موتور دیفرانسیل کارلز بابیج در سال 1843 توسعه یافت.

امروزه مردم هنوز از بسیاری از سیستم های برنامه نویسی و زبان های برنامه نویسی استفاده می کنند. با این حال، لیست محبوب ترین ها شامل 150 زبان است.

محبوب ترین زبان های برنامه نویسی کدامند؟

در اینجا یک راهنمای مفید برای پیگیری زبان های برنامه نویسی محبوب ترین هستند. دایرکتوری انجمن برنامه نویسی TiOBE این رتبه بندی ها را ماهانه بر اساس تعداد مهندسان ماهر در سراسر جهان و عواملی مانند دوره های آموزشی موجود و فروشندگان شخص ثالث پیگیری می کند.

برخی از بهترین زبان های برنامه نویسی عبارتند از:

  • C
  • Java
  • Python
  • C++
  • C#
  • Visual Basic
  • JavaScript
  • PHP
  • SQL
  • Assembly language
  • R
  • Groovy

اگر امیدوارید برای وب کدنویسی کنید یا از زبان هایی مانند جاوا اسکریپت استفاده کنید، باید درک خوبی از HTML و CSS داشته باشید.

انواع زبان برنامه نویسی

مقایسه انواع زبان های برنامه نویسی

همانطور که متوجه شدیم، از زبان های برنامه نویسی مختلف برای کارهای مختلفی که کامپیوترها می توانند انجام دهند استفاده می شود. اما بیایید دقیق تر صحبت کنیم. ابتدا یک تفاوت کوچک را بررسی می کنیم.

محبوب ترین زبان های برنامه نویسی آنهایی هستند که به عنوان شی گرا شناخته می شوند. زبان های برنامه نویسی شی گرا به راحتی قابل دستکاری، استفاده مجدد و مقیاس هستند و آنها را برای برنامه نویسی نرم افزار ایده آل می کند.

نوع مهم دیگر زبان برنامه نویسی برنامه نویسی تابعی است. این زبان ها بر اساس عملیات ریاضی و با استفاده از منطق خطی محاسبه می شوند. آنها برای مواردی مانند فهرست نویسی برنامه های کاربردی و تجزیه و تحلیل داده های بزرگ مفید هستند.

در زیر، ما به برخی از محبوب ترین زبان های برنامه نویسی و کاربردهای آنها نگاه کرده ایم:

C

بیایید با یکی از پایدارترین زبان های برنامه نویسی که امروزه استفاده می شود شروع کنیم، C.همچنین زبان بسیار تاثیرگذاری است و دانستن اصول اولیه آن مفید است.

زبان برنامه نویسی C برای اولین بار در سال 1972 منتشر شد. این یک زبان برنامه نویسی سطح بالا است که به یکی از پرکاربردترین زبان های موجود تبدیل شد‌ه است. علیرغم قدمت آن، این زبان هنوز یک زبان پیچیده است، اما تأثیر آن را می توان در بسیاری از زبان های دیگر مشاهده کرد. جاگر تازه کدنویسی را یاد می گیرید، مکان های بهتری برای شروع وجود دارد.

C چیست؟

C یک زبان برنامه نویسی سطح بالا است که در سال 1992 راه اندازی شد. این زبان به گونه ای ساخته شد‌ه است که یادگیری و درک آن نسبتاً شهودی است و برای کسانی که می خواهند به سرعت توسعه دهند ایده آل است. این زبان در حال حاضر بسیار محبوب است، به این معنی که پروژه های پایتون زیادی وجود دارد.

C برای چه مواردی استفاده می شود؟

C به دلیل تطبیق پذیری زبان، کاربردهای زیادی دارد. علاوه بر این که برای استفاده عمومی مانند برنامه های کاربردی وب مفید است، حوزه های تخصصی زیادی نیز دارد. یک مثال خوب از دومی، هوش مصنوعی (AI) و یادگیری ماشین است.

جاوا

یکی دیگر از نقاط شروع مفید برای برنامه نویسی، یادگیری جاوا است. این یک زبان با هدف عمومی و با هدف عمومی مشابه جاوا اسکریپت و پایتون است.

جاوا چیست؟

یک زبان برنامه نویسی بسیار محبوب است.بخشی از محبوبیت آن این است که وقتی یک قطعه کد را در جاوا می نویسید، می توانید آن را تقریباً روی هر دستگاهی با پلتفرم جاوا اجرا کنید.

جاوا برای چه مواردی استفاده می شود؟

مفهوم “یک بار بنویس، هر جا اجرا کن” در قلب جاوا به این معنی است که کاربردهای زیادی دارد. با این حال، برخی از کاربردهای اصلی شامل نرم افزارهای تجاری، برنامه های کاربردی وب و برنامه های کاربردی تلفن همراه است. به عنوان مثال، دستگاه اندرویدی گوگل از جاوا به عنوان زبان مادری خود استفاده می کند.

نحوه یادگیری جاوا

شما می توانید با دوره های رایگان ما در زمینه ساخت اولین بازی موبایل خود، اصول برنامه نویسی جاوا را شروع کنید. شما را با مفاهیم و تعاریف مهم جاوا آشنا می کند.

R چیست؟

R یک زبان برنامه نویسی کاربردی و سطح پایین و محیط نرم افزاری است که عمدتاً تکنیک های محاسباتی و گرافیکی را هدف قرار می دهد. کتابخانه بزرگی از ابزارها شامل الگوریتم‌های یادگیری ماشین و سایر ابزارهای مفید همراه با این زبان وجود دارد.

R برای چه مواردی استفاده می شود؟

حسابداران و داده کاویان اغلب از R برای توسعه مواردی مانند نرم افزارهای آماری و بسته های تجزیه و تحلیل داده ها استفاده می کنند. همچنین برای افراد حرفه ای مانند روانشناسان، دانشمندان داده و بیمه گران برای درک آمار مفید است.

نحوه نوشتن R

یک مکان عالی برای شروع برنامه نویسی به این زبان، Data Science در Microsoft Azure با استفاده از Expert Programming R است. همانطور که در مسیر خود کار می کنید، برنامه نویسی R را یاد می گیرید و مهارت های علم داده خود را توسعه می دهید.

انواع زبان برنامه نویسی

SQL چیست؟

زبان پرس و جو ساختاریافته (SQL که گاهی اوقات دنباله نیز نامیده می شود)، یک زبان دامنه خاص است که برای مدیریت داده های ذخیره شد‌ه در پایگاه های داده طراحی شد‌ه است. برخلاف بسیاری از زبان های برنامه نویسی مختلف که تاکنون ذکر شد، این یک زبان عمومی نیست، به این معنی که استفاده از آن بسیار محدودتر است.

SQL برای چه مواردی استفاده می شود؟

SQL عمدتا برای برقراری ارتباط با پایگاه های داده استفاده می شود. به این ترتیب، توسط توسعه دهندگان سرور، مدیران پایگاه داده و توسعه دهندگان نرم افزار در طیف گسترده ای از صنایع استفاده می شود. با این حال، اخیراً در زمینه هایی مانند تجزیه و تحلیل داده ها و کلان داده کاوی نیز استفاده شد‌ه است.

نحوه یادگیری SQL

اگر در این موضوع تازه کار هستید، آشنایی با پایگاه های داده و SQL مکانی ایده آل برای شروع است. در اینجا نحوه کار پایگاه داده ها و نحوه استفاده از SQL برای جستجو و دستکاری داده ها را خواهید آموخت.

طراحی سایت در هشتگرد

شرکت آینده البرز واقع در هشتگرد آماده خدمت رسانی در زمینه های طراحی سایت ساخت اپلیکیشن و… میباشد.

 

  • هنوز دیدگاهی وجود ندارد.
  • افزودن دیدگاه